When the spore is mature, the sporangium opens to release the spores, allowing them to be dispersed and germinate to form new organisms. This process is important for the reproduction and survival of many plant and fungi species.
The capsule in which spores are formed is called a sporangium. In fungi, the sporangium is responsible for producing and containing spores, which are then released for reproduction. In plants, particularly in ferns, the sporangium is often found on the undersides of leaves and plays a similar role in the life cycle.

A mature sporangium typically releases spores, which are reproductive cells that can develop into new individuals. The sporangium undergoes a process called dehiscence, where it opens to disperse these spores into the environment. This dispersal allows for potential germination and growth into new organisms, continuing the life cycle of the parent organism. In some cases, the sporangium may also provide protection or nourishment to the developing spores before they are released.

The columella in a sporangium helps support the spore-producing structures, as well as aids in the dispersal of spores. It also plays a role in regulating the release of spores by controlling the opening and closing of the sporangium.
